Abstract
The utility model belongs to construction engineering technical field, in particular a kind of architectural engineering steel bar connector, including left continued access block, threaded hole one is equipped at the top of the fixed plate, the threaded hole one is connected with threaded post one by screw thread, and the fixed plate bottom side is equipped with the first buckle slot, first buckle slot is connected with fixture block, the fixture block bottom is fixedly connected with elastic webbing, is equipped with threaded hole two at the top of the arc panel, the threaded hole two is connected with threaded post two by screw thread;By being equipped with fixture block and buckle slot, it is convenient to operate, fixture block is used in combination with buckle slot, it is convenient that continued access block tentatively fix, while reducing operational instrument, it is used in combination by being equipped with threaded hole two with threaded post two, the robustness for guaranteeing the adapter is guaranteed between fixture block and auxiliary fastening block by being equipped with elastic webbing by elasticated, to make the adapter be adapted to different steel bar joinings, and then guarantee the being widely used property of the adapter.

Background technique
Steel bar joining is that engineering method is often used in architectural engineering, since bridge pier height increase in recent years, skyscraper are more and more common,
For steel bar joining engineering method using more and more, reinforcing bar length has fixed range requirement, so in construction, it has to take continued access steel
The mode of muscle is to lengthen reinforcing bar length, and to meet practice of construction requirement, however the soundness of steel bar joining and building is resistance to
It is closely related to shake intensity, therefore comparable attention should be given to steel bar joining.
Existing technology has the following problems:
1, existing apparatus needs two people to operate when in use, needs to carry out adapter tentatively to fix, causes to carry out
It lavishes labor on, results in waste of resources when continued access;
2, existing apparatus is only fixed reinforcing bar when carrying out continued access, and reinforcing bar rocks splicing device can be made to open and close,
Cause continued access to fail, or even will appear dangerous generation;
3, existing apparatus can only carry out continued access to a kind of reinforcing bar, need different splicing devices to the reinforcing bar of different model, no
It is only time-consuming and laborious, adapter cannot be made to be widely used.
